WinCC:如何在WinCC中调用SQL语言?

问:如何在WinCC中调用SQL语言?

答:

1、创建一个SQL文件,此文件在ISQL中建立,文件内包含所要执行的SQL语句。Windows对话框实现。具体如下:

2、在WinCC中用CScript调用上述SQL文件,如下所示:

#include "apdefap.h"
void OnLButtonDown (char* lpszPictureName,
char* lpszObjectName,
char* lpszPropertyName,
UINT nFlags, int x, int y)
{
	char*a="C:\\SIEMENS\\Common\\SQLANY\\ISQL-q-b-c
	UID=DBA;PWD=SQL;DBF=E:\\testsql\\testsqlRT.DB;
	DBN=CC_testsql_99-12-03_12:48:26R;READ
	E:\\testsql\\test.sql";
	printf("%s\r\n",a);
	ProgramExecute(a);
}

下面是一个简单的SQL文件内容:

select * from pde#hd#t#test;
output to E:\\test2.txt FORMAT ascii

注意:文件名及路径中不要带空格。

—— 完 ——
相关推荐
评论

立 为 非 似

中 谁 昨 此

宵 风 夜 星

。 露 , 辰

文章点击榜

细 无 轻 自

如 边 似 在

愁 丝 梦 飞

。 雨 , 花